Details of the Tax Legislation

The new tax cut legislation is designed to support a wide range of residents across Multnomah County. Here are the key details:

  • Average Tax Cut Amount: $3,414
  • Effective Date: The tax cut will take effect in the upcoming fiscal year, starting July 1, 2024.
  • Target Audience: The tax relief is aimed at low- to middle-income households, providing much-needed support for families.
  • Funding Sources: The tax cuts will be funded through a combination of increased revenue from tourism and business growth within the county.
